rcuscale: Permit blocking delays between writers
authorPaul E. McKenney <paulmck@kernel.org>
Tue, 16 May 2023 14:02:01 +0000 (07:02 -0700)
committerPaul E. McKenney <paulmck@kernel.org>
Fri, 14 Jul 2023 22:01:48 +0000 (15:01 -0700)
Some workloads do isolated RCU work, and this can affect operation
latencies.  This commit therefore adds a writer_holdoff_jiffies module
parameter that causes writers to block for the specified number of
jiffies between each pair of consecutive write-side operations.
